Historical Context and Technological Foundations
Facial recognition technology traces its origins to early research in biometric analysis during the 1960s, but meaningful commercial deployment only gained momentum with the advent of machine learning and computer vision breakthroughs in the last decade. Modern FRT employs deep convolutional neural networks (CNNs), which have demonstrated remarkable accuracy in facial identification tasks.
According to industry data, recent models achieve identification accuracies exceeding 99% in controlled environments, with real-world scenarios presenting more challenges due to variable factors such as lighting, angles, and occlusions. This rapid progress reflects a broader trend toward integrating artificial intelligence (AI) with biometric systems to enhance speed and reliability.
Current Industry Trends and Innovations
Several key developments are shaping the future of FRT:
- Multimodal Biometrics: Combining facial recognition with other biometric modalities like voice and gait analysis enhances robustness.
- Edge Computing Integration: Processing data locally on devices reduces latency and mitigates privacy concerns.
- Privacy-Preserving Techniques: Implementation of federated learning and differential privacy aims to protect individuals’ data while maintaining system performance.
- Adaptive Algorithms: Systems that learn and calibrate in real-time to environmental changes improve accuracy in dynamic settings.

Impact on Society and Ethical Concerns
Despite technological advances, FRT raises significant ethical questions. Critics highlight risks related to:
- Mass surveillance and potential invasions of privacy
- Biases embedded in training datasets leading to disparate impact across demographics
- Misidentification and false positives, especially affecting marginalized groups
- Legal frameworks lagging behind technological capabilities, creating regulatory vacuum
It is crucial for developers, policymakers, and civil society to collaborate on establishing transparent standards and accountability measures. Recent research emphasizes the importance of external audits and bias mitigation strategies to ensure FRT serves society ethically and equitably.
Case Studies and Future Outlook
Major urban centers worldwide have piloted facial recognition systems for public safety. For instance, in London, law enforcement agencies have partnered with tech firms to deploy FRT in high-traffic areas, aiming to expedite identity verification during events with high security risk.
However, these initiatives often face public backlash due to privacy concerns. Looking ahead, industry experts predict a more balanced integration of FRT, emphasizing consent and data minimization. Advances in explainable AI (XAI) are expected to foster greater transparency, helping to build public trust.
Expert analyses suggest that ethical deployment paired with technological sophistication will determine FRT’s role in society over the next decade.
